Understanding the Science of Sunscreen and Best Skin Health
Before diving into specific benefits, it’s essential to understand how sunscreen works. Sunscreen creates a protective barrier that absorbs or reflects harmful ultraviolet (UV) rays. These rays, primarily UVA and UVB, damage the skin’s DNA, leading to sunburn, hyperpigmentation, and long-term issues like skin cancer. For melanin-rich skin, while the natural pigment offers some UV protection, it’s not enough to prevent cumulative damage.
How Sunscreen Enhances Skin Health
- Prevention of Hyperpigmentation: Melanin-rich skin is prone to dark spots and uneven tone caused by sun exposure. Sunscreen minimizes these effects, keeping your complexion even.
- Protection Against Premature Aging: UV exposure breaks down collagen and elastin, leading to fine lines and wrinkles. Sunscreen acts as a shield, preserving your skin’s youthful appearance.
- Barrier Against Skin Cancer: Regular use of sunscreen reduces the risk of UV-induced skin cancer, ensuring long-term health.
Sunscreen Myths in Melanin-Rich Skin Care
Myth 1: “I Don’t Need Sunscreen Because I Have Dark Skin.”
Fact: While melanin provides some natural SPF (estimated around 13), it’s far from sufficient. Dermatologists recommend SPF 30 or higher for effective protection.
Myth 2: “Sunscreen Leaves a White Cast on My Skin.”

Myth 3: “I Only Need Sunscreen in the Summer.”
Fact: UV rays are present year-round, even on cloudy days. Daily sunscreen use is essential for consistent protection.
Choosing the Right Sunscreen for the Best Skin Health
Not all sunscreens are created equal. Here are key factors to consider:
- Broad-Spectrum Protection: Ensure your sunscreen protects against both UVA and UVB rays.
- SPF Level: Opt for SPF 30 or higher for effective defense.
- Non-Comedogenic Formulas: Choose sunscreens that won’t clog pores, especially for acne-prone skin.

Incorporating Sunscreen into Your Daily Routine
Achieving the best skin health doesn’t require a complicated regimen. Here’s a simple routine:
- Morning Cleansing: Start with a gentle cleanser to remove impurities.
- Moisturizing: Apply a lightweight moisturizer suitable for your skin type.
- Sunscreen Application: Use a generous amount of sunscreen, covering all exposed areas, including the face, neck, and hands.
- Reapplication: Reapply every two hours, especially if outdoors or after sweating.
By making sunscreen a daily habit, you’re investing in long-term skin resilience and confidence.
